QUOTE(joanalooidog @ Aug 1 2008, 09:12 AM)
Hi all. Is it true that the lower the rpm reading, the better of the car's fc?

Currently I'm driving a b14 sentra '97(A).
RPM = 2700 @ 110km/h
The FC is around 11-13km /l

I'm interested to know others car like toyota seg 1.6, myvi 1.3, toyota vios, city idsi, hyundai getz 1.4. Both auto and manual............
others model are welcome also, thanks.

summary :

Model            RPM @ 110 km/h
nissan sentra b14 1.6(A)  2.7k
sentra b14 SR16VE engine 3.3k
nissan sunny 1.3(M)        2.6k
getz 1.3            2.6k
kelisa 1.0(M)          3k
kelisa 1.0(A)          3.7k
kancil 660(M)          4.2k
kancil 850EX(M)                4.2k
myvi 1.0(M)        3.6k
myvi 1.3(A)        3k
kenari 1.0(A)        3.6k
kenari 1.0(M)                  3.4k
viva 1.0 (A)                    3.7k
saga blm 1.3(A)        3.1k
saga blm 1.3(M)              3.6k
waja cps (M)        3.2k
waja mitsu(M)                2.9k
savvy amt                      3.6k
gen2 campro      >3k
persona            3.2k
wira 1.5(M)          3.2k
wira 1.5(A)                    3.8k
wira 1.6(A)          2.6k
wira 1.6 mivec(A)      2.5k
wira 1.6(M) F5M221XPXL GB  3.1k
wira 1.3(M)                      3.2k
iswara 1.3(M)          3.5k
iswara 1.5(A)                  >3.9k    shocking.gif
satria gti            3k
satria neo 1.6(A)      3k
satria 1.6(M)                  2.8k
perdana v6                      2.8k
honda civic eg 1.6(A)      3.1k
honda city idsi          2.7k
honda city vtec                2.5k
Honda City 2009 i-VTEC (5AT)  2.5k @ 120km/h
honda accord 2.0(A)        2.3k
honda accord 2.4(A)        2k
honda accord CB3            3k
civic ej8 b16a(M)        4k
civic fd2 1.8                    2.35k
honda crv(3rd gen)      2.1k
vios 1.5(A)          2.5k
camry 2.4(A)        2.1k
toyota seg 1.6(A) ae111    2.5k
avanza 1.3(A)                  4k
wish 2.0(A)                      2k
wish 1.8(A)                      2.9k
lexus rx300 3.0(A)      2.7k
suzuki swift          2.7k
Isuzu Trooper 4JG2          3k
kia carens 1.8(A)            2.9k
naza suria 1.1(A)            3k
hyundai accent 1.5(A)      2.5k
fiat punto 1.2(CVT)      2.2k
mitsubishi galant 1.8(M)    3.1k
Mitsu Lancer 2.4l (4g69)  3.1k
mazda 929 2.0(A)    2k
mazda 323 1.6(M)          3.5k
chevy optra 1.6        2.5k
chevy aveo                      2.5k
bmw e90 325i 2.5(A)    2.2k
freelander td4 2.0 diesel    2k
citroen c3 1.6 (semiAuto)  2.3k
ford lynx 1.8(A)                2.75k
golf gti                            2.6k
saab 9-5aero                    2.1k
saab 9-3aero                    1.8k
my Audi A4 2.0(A)            2.2k
Benz C200                        2.9k

I've driven a few cars mainly from Proton. I suspect the speedometer itself isn't entirely accurate after comparing to Garmin GPS (perhaps other phone GPS navigation speed meter can cross check also) speed meter doesn't tally during the journey. I recall seeing Proton speedo under register the actual speed to GPS, about 5km/h off, but Perodua Myvi meter is nearly spot on. I assume Toyota would be spot on too. My findings is from using the same Garmin GPS in all these cars going outstation journey.
So begs the question, are all those 110km/hr readings really spot on? Which can be erratic? The car speedo or the GPS?
